Wudu
//ˈwuːduː// noun
noun 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 A ritual washing of the forearms, head, and feet, required after minor impurity, frequently performed immediately before prayer. uncountable
- 2 The state of purity that is achieved by this washing. uncountable
Synonyms
All synonymsEtymology
Borrowed from Arabic وُضُوء (wuḍūʔ).
